INTRODUCTION

It has been observed for years that reading difficulties are one of the major problems in school. It was found out that this problem greatly affects the academic performance of pupils in English. It can be seen also in the Phil-Iri result of assessment that 50% of the pupils were at the frustration level. Thus, the researcher was motivated to come up with varied strategies to develop the pupils so they will become better in their academic performance in English and enhance their reading skills.

 

METHODS

The descriptive-correlational method was utilized in this study. The proponent used the varied strategies in teaching reading instruction to her pupils wherein it seems to be effective in solving the reading difficulties of pupils. One of the strategies used was the Teacher -pupil contact, this is also known as one-on-one strategy wherein the teacher keeps her focus on one pupil at a time. The teacher prepared many reading materials for the mastery of phonemes and for those who could not recognize letter sounds. For the next level of phonics, instructional materials for the beginning reader were also utilized. Cooperative Learning was also utilized. In this method, the researchers produced colorful books, printed reading materials, and displayed charts to encourage children to hold and read books. Though at first, they only scan pictures of the book, yet through the help of intelligent pupils in class, they helped their classmates how to read the printed words.

 

RESULTS

Based on the data gathered, it showed that there is a significant relationship between the reading difficulties and their performance in English. The varied teaching strategies that were utilized were effective because the number of pupils-at-risks decreased by 20% based on the data of this study.

 

DISCUSSIONS

It is the basic function of a teacher to teach the pupils every day. They must know the strengths and weaknesses of their pupils to be able to come up with appropriate reading strategies specially for the struggling readers. When teaching learners in reading the foundation, the teacher has to start with decoding, phonemic awareness, then phonics, sight words and then, vocabulary. In order to succeed in teaching the children to read, a teacher must be well-trained in research-based on reading instructional methods.
